What is a timbre?

  1. The quality of a musical sound

  2. The pitch of a musical sound

  3. The duration of a musical sound

  4. The volume of a musical sound

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Timbre is the quality of a musical sound. Timbre is what distinguishes the sound of one instrument from the sound of another.

Which part of the ear is responsible for converting sound waves into electrical signals?

  1. Cochlea

  2. Vestibular system

  3. Tympanic membrane

  4. Pinna

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

The cochlea is a spiral-shaped structure in the inner ear that contains sensory cells called hair cells. These hair cells convert sound waves into electrical signals, which are then transmitted to the brain.

Which room acoustic treatment is commonly used to reduce reverberation and improve clarity?

  1. Diffusion

  2. Absorption

  3. Reflection

  4. Damping

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Absorption is a room acoustic treatment that involves the use of materials that absorb sound energy, reducing reverberation and improving clarity.
